what is a complex and compound sentence?

Answers

Explanation:

A compound-complex sentence is comprised of at least two independent clauses and one or more dependent clauses. Example: Though Mitchell prefers watching romantic films, he rented the latest spy thriller, and he enjoyed it very much

.

Answer:

1. COMPLEX SENTENCE has one dependent clause (headed by a subordinating conjunction or a relative pronoun ) joined to an independent clause.

2. COMPOUND SENTENCE has two independent clauses joined by

A. a coordinating conjunction (for, and, nor, but, or, yet, so),

B. a conjunctive adverb (e.g. however, therefore), or

C. a semicolon alone.

What’s the difference between personal troubles and public issues.

Answers

Answer:

Personal troubles occur on individual level (limited by the scope of one's biography), while public issues transcend the individual and are collective interests or values felt to be threatened.
